Vortech Tuned at CPR
Well....I just got back from Charlotte.
Many thanks to the guys at CPR....they did a great job on my car!!!
Eric and Ralph are the masters.
I was kinda disappointed though......the 9lb pulleys are on backorder so I had to stick with my stock one.
Good thing though......they said "WOW....you got a good set up going here....
You dont NEED a smaller pulley!"
As I told them I wanted the "Safe....Conservitive Tune"....and not a "Squeeze it till it Bleeds" type tune........When we first started, the Vortech was making about 330 hp with it's pig rich out of the box program. After about 30 dynos and lots of tweaking....it got better.
At one point , I was in the 400 club....but we actually backed it down some for safety and it only made......
395.2 HP...@ 8 psi & 340 ft lb torque.
I'm happy with that!
